Fenrir, there are a few problems with that:

A. It can mess up any word(s) that might have the mis-spelling of a word in the middle of a word. The filter searches for all instances of the letters included, whether they're in the middle of a word or sitting alone, and replaces them. I had some common grammar/spelling things in the filter at one point and it messed up a lot of people's posts so I took them out.

B. It can mess you up if you *want* to say "teh" or something similar on purpose. Not that a lot of us would do that, but there are some people who do that.
